Course Description
Overview
This course applies the principles of effective and ethical communication to the creation of letters, memos, emails, and written and oral reports for a variety of business situations. The course emphasizes the development, analysis, organization, and composition of various types of professionally written messages, analytical reports, and business presentations using word processing and presentation-graphics software. Other topics include interpersonal communication, electronic media, and international/cross-cultural communication. This course is intended for students majoring in business and for others working in a business environment.
